As the stablecoin wars continue to heat up, Bitfinex is looking to bring USDT to more blockchains, announcing earlier today that it will launch its stablecoin on EOS’s blockchain. Currently, Tether is issued on the Omni Layer, Ethereum, and TRON. In the next couple of weeks, the company is also planning to issue USDT on Blockstream’s federated sidechain Liquid.

But chief technology officer Paolo Ardoino told The Block that the firm has ambitions to bring the stablecoin to other blockchains, saying that it will launch the coin on Lightning Network sometime this year. As part of those efforts, Bitfinex has joined a group of developers and companies called RGB, which is working to put more assets on the Lightning Network.

Tether would be the first mainstream asset to be issued on the Lightning Network, which could help the second layer protocol in furthering its adoption. Tether’s competitors, USD Coin, TrueUSD, PAX, Gemini dollar are all issued exclusively on Ethereum.
